To commemorate the 150th anniversary of Austrian-Japanese friendship, the MAK presents two exhibitions: "KUNIYOSHI +: Design and Entertainment in Japanese Woodblock Prints" and "UKIYOENOW: Tradition and Experiment".
The first presentation is devoted to the late period of the ukiyo-e. The show's main spotlight is on one of the most important and innovative artists of the nineteenth century, Utagawa Kuniyoshi (1797-1861). In contrast, "UKIYOENOW: Tradition and Experiment" opens up new dimensions in the contemporary treatment of the Japanese art form and poses the question of how far the different forms of production-traditional handicraft and digital print-and also the new context of global/transnational pop cultures are impacting the further development of the ukiyo-e.
